Housing market decline hits Ichiro's mansion

Postby Bucky » Thu Mar 26, 2009 1:45 am

Image
Ichiro Suzuki didn't field many offers for his original asking price of $3.2 million for his Issaquah mansion. The M's star built a bigger home on Lake Sammamish and left this Issaquah home three years ago.

The new number is now down to $1.75 million, and there are people in town coughing up that kind of cash without a jumbo loan.
  • 5 br, 4 ba
  • 4920 sq. ft.
